i know that this question was probably asked before but if i change my stock intake manifold to a Fast 92mm intake manifold will i pass smog and will the service engine light come on?

if your car came equipped with an EGR....and you don't install it on the FAST...than yeah you probably would fail emissions...as well as trip a code.

if you have a non-egr car from the factory (01-02 fbody) than it would bolt right up. no codes...theoreticaly you should pass emissions.

HOWEVER if it throws your a/f off...it could cause you to fail the smog test
